Transaction 51ddee7277bff039a733e7715bb5e6126bda1b78c9e4c65f14d6524a7a9ed72f
1 Input
1 Output
-
51ddee7277bff039a733e7715bb5e6126bda1b78c9e4c65f14d6524a7a9ed72f:0
- value
- 8381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cbd8921a5aaa47aae1a1ba7f42d83b556137420 OP_EQUAL
- address
- 3BbyxRvvPaWCeHrUgbGo51MEsjbUxzxukU